PDA

View Full Version : این errorبرای چیست؟



samira83
شنبه 13 مرداد 1386, 08:21 صبح
در هنگام برقراری ارتباط asp &c#با sql با این خطا برخورد می کنم.


Server Error in '/Dentistry' Application.
Login failed for user 'NAZARI\ASPNET'.
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.Data.SqlClient.SqlException: Login failed for user 'NAZARI\ASPNET'.
Source Error:
Line 35: delCommand.CommandText="Select * from dentist";
Line 36: delCommand.CommandType=CommandType.Text;
Line 37: sqlConnection1.Open();
Line 38: sqlDataAdapter1.Fill(dataSet31);
Line 39: DataGrid1.DataBind();

ClaimAlireza
شنبه 13 مرداد 1386, 09:16 صبح
1- آیا سرویس sql اجرا شده؟

2- اگر user و pass برای سرویس sql تعریف کردین چک کنید درست واردشون کنید.

3- آیا local server رو توی sql رجیستر کردین؟

Behrouz_Rad
شنبه 13 مرداد 1386, 09:30 صبح
در SQL Server به کاربر NAZARI\ASPNET مجوز دسترسی به دیتابیس رو بده.

موفق باشید.

samira83
شنبه 13 مرداد 1386, 09:41 صبح
ممنون از جوابتون.sqlنصب کردم.datagridهم fieldهای جدول رو نشون میده.اسم sqlserveram=NAZARIاست.SQL ام با WINDOWS AUTHENTICATION است.لطفا بفرمایین چطور باید CONNECTIONاین دو رو برقرار کنم.با C# کار میکنم.

Behrouz_Rad
شنبه 13 مرداد 1386, 09:48 صبح
توضیح اضافه ای وجود نداره.
در این مورد تحقیق کن که به چه شکل میتونی به یک کاربر سیستم مجوز دسترسی به دیتابیس رو در SQL Server بدی.

این سوال رو یک بار حذف کردم چون تکراری بود و بارها در این مورد بحث شده.

موفق باشید.